When it comes to cleaning personal aquariums, Christie said there were a few ways.
"Maintaining a clean aquarium is incredibly important for the health and wellbeing of its residents.
"It is important to regularly clean your tanks – whether they be freshwater or saltwater – and ensure all your filtration systems are working properly. It is also important to check your fish are looking healthy," Christie said.
For the ideal environment, there was a "balance you must find".
"There is fish produce waste products and the food that is not eaten, you are basically creating a whole environment for them to live in.
"It's not just like having sheep on a farm where there is air and grass. We have to create the whole environment."
The frequency of cleaning was key, a daily ritual for the divers at Kelly's.
"I'm happy if divers are in there every day.
